#3df23e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3df23e is composed of 23.9% red, 94.9%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.4%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 120.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 59.4%. #3df23e color hex could be obtained by blending #7aff7c with #00e500.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#3df23e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3df23e has RGB values of R:61, G:242,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4059710.

Shades and Tints of #3df23e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010801 is the darkest color, while #f5f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3df23e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959a95 is the less saturated color, while #35fa36 is the most saturated one.
